Transaction

dbe6ef033f3c8f3e0c1d2a6042e5f7c3cc6fac02c446ae2936a72ea8f273ff18
360,429 confirmations
Timestamp
1557279890
Block575,056
Fee14,960 sats
Fee rate40.2 sats/vB
view on mempool.space

Inputs & Outputs